What is a‌ Phlebotomy Agency?

A phlebotomy agency specializes in recruiting trained phlebotomists for various healthcare settings such as⁤ hospitals, ⁤clinics, and laboratories.These agencies serve as ⁤intermediaries, connecting job seekers with employers, handling the hiring ‍process, and often providing additional training and resources.

Benefits‌ of Working with a Phlebotomy Agency

  • Access to Job Opportunities: agencies frequently⁣ enough have exclusive ⁤contracts with healthcare facilities, giving their ⁣members access to job openings before they are advertised elsewhere.
  • Flexible Work options: Many agencies offer temporary, part-time, and⁢ full-time positions ⁣that allow you to choose your work hours and locations.
  • Career Growth: Agencies frequently ‍provide ‍training programs, certifications, and skill development opportunities, enhancing your qualifications.
  • Networking: Working with an agency allows you to meet industry ‌professionals and⁣ build valuable connections that⁤ can further your career.
  • support Services: many agencies assist ⁣with resume writing, interview preparation, and ongoing ⁤career ​guidance to help you succeed.

Challenges of Working with Phlebotomy Agencies

While ther are numerous benefits to joining ⁤a phlebotomy ⁣agency, it’s critically important to consider potential challenges as ​well:

  • Inconsistent Work: Some agency positions might potentially be temporary or part-time, leading to fluctuations in income.
  • Limited Control: You may have less control over your specific job assignments ⁤and locations.
  • Agency Fees: Some agencies ⁣may charge ​fees, which can‍ reduce your overall ‌earnings.
